Itinerary

Day 1

Meet & check-in at Aviario Nacional de Colombia

08:00 – 10:15 • 2h 15m

Meet at the entrance to the National Aviary (Km 14.5 Vía Barú). Short registration, then a guided 2-hour tour of aviary enclosures and observation paths. Two bottles of water per person are provided during the tour.

Km 14.5 Vía Barú, Cartagena, Bolívar, Colombia

Tips from local experts:

  • Arrive 10–15 minutes before the start time to complete registration at the aviary entrance.
  • Wear lightweight, breathable clothing and closed shoes; bring a hat and sunscreen—some observation paths have limited shade.
  • This site is not wheelchair accessible; supervise children near enclosures and do not climb barriers.

Transfer to Isla del Encanto — buffet lunch and hotel pool/beach time

10:15 – 15:00 • 4h 45m

After the aviary tour, transfer by air-conditioned vehicle/boat to Isla del Encanto. Enjoy the included buffet lunch (non-alcoholic beverage included) and use of hotel facilities: pool, beds and sunbeds. Time allocated for swimming, sun and beach relaxation before return to the meeting point.

Isla del Encanto, Barú, Cartagena, Bolívar, Colombia

Tips from local experts:

  • Bring swimwear, a towel, and reef-safe sunscreen; sunbeds and pool access are included with the activity.
  • If travelling with young children, bring swim diapers and a change of clothes; supervise children at the pool and on the beach at all times.
  • Alcoholic drinks are not included; confirm any special dietary needs with the guide before the buffet service begins.
